What is LAUCC 2009?

LAUCC, short for Latin American Unicycle Championship and Convention, is the first unicycle convention and championship ever realized in South America! It will held Street, Flatland, Trials High and Long Jump competitions!

Where and when it’s going to be?

This year LAUCC will be held in Santiago, Chile, from Octuber 30 to November 1! LAUCC it’s a roving event and each year will take place in a different Latin American country!
